Audionautix

Best for: Mood-specific music by genre or tempo.

audionautix

Jason Shaw is the brainchild and creator of Audionautix, where you can find an amazing library of royalty-free tracks. The music search page is user-friendly, where you can search music by tempo, genre, or mood.

Features

  • Downloads are free, and no signup is required.
  • Available for free, personal and commercial.
  • A donation-based platform.

Usage: You will need to add your video description and attribution to Jason Shaw.

MusOpen

Best for: Classical music lovers.

musopen

A treasure trove of classical music can be reached with MusOpen, featuring the compositions of legends such as Mozart, Beethoven, and Bach. A lot of tracks are in the public domain and copyright-free.

Features

  • With a free account, you can download up to 5 free downloads daily.
  • Organized by mood, composer, and category.
  • Works best for historical or serious-themed content.

Usage: Public domain works do not require attribution, and you are still allowed to use them.

YouTube Audio Library

Best for: With easy integration of YouTube content.

youtube audio library

If you are a YouTuber, then you know that YouTube has a built-in resource called the YouTube Audio Library. It has over 1,000 tracks and 300 sound effects and is accessible via your YouTube account.

Features

  • Music available for monetized videos.
  • Genre, mood, and duration filtering.
  • Clear attribution requirements.

Usage: Make sure always to check if one or more tracks require attribution.

Unminus

Best for: Attribution-free and unlimited usage.

unminus

Unminus stands out with its Creative Commons Zero (CCO), so you can use tracks without crediting the artist.

Features

  • Completely royalty-free and unrestricted.
  • Tracks are categorized by mood and genre.
  • Simple and clean interface.

Usage: Get Music for personal or commercial use without limitations.

FAQs

Are all free music tracks really copyright free?

Not all free music tracks are copyright free. Each website requires you to check its licensing terms to be sure the music is in the public domain or licensed for free use, often under Creative Commons licenses.

Do I need to attribute the creators for all tracks?

Attribution requirements differ at each site and track. Finally, some platforms have the Creative Commons Zero (CCO) licenses or don’t require attribution, such as Unminus, some others, like Audionautix, TeknoAXE, or FreeMusicArchive, require you to credit the creator in your video description.

Are these free music tracks free to use for commercial YouTube videos?

Many free music tracks can be used for commercial use, but make sure each track is licensed. As long as you follow their guidelines, there are platforms like MusOpen, Audionautix, and YouTube Audio Library to pick tracks that are okay for monetized videos.

What should I do if my video gets flagged for copyright despite using free music?

Check if the music you are using is available under the platform’s licensing terms. You can dispute a claim if you think it’s incorrect by giving proof of your license or attribution. Log your sources and your licenses all the time.
